Capacity note — Brightalms receipt mailer

For the support team: the donation-receipt mailer runs on the Oakhollow job tier and sends receipts in batches rather than instantly, so a delay of a few minutes is normal, not an outage. During year-end giving, volume roughly triples and the queue can hold 40k pending receipts without trouble. If donors report delays beyond an hour, check queue depth before escalating. The batch sizes and send-rate constants currently in effect are below.

tuning table, yajog-yahof:
BUDGETS = {
    "lamvan": 303,
    "wenox": 460,
    "fenvan": 525,
}

Plugin authors integrating with the Vaultspin rotation utility must declare every secret their plugin reads in the manifest, including derived credentials. During rotation, Vaultspin issues a pre-rotation hook with a 60-second deadline; plugins that fail to acknowledge are detached until the next cycle. Never cache secrets beyond a single invocation. The hook contract and manifest schema are described on the internal page below.

wiki page, bajog-tahop: https://confluence.qorvelsys.internal/browse/pages/pages/pages

## Further reading

Experiment VELVET-PRICE tested dynamic ticket pricing on the Starloft events platform. Ran six weeks, three cohorts, capped surge at 1.4x. Revenue up, refund complaints up too. Pricing logic lives in the fare-engine service; cohort assignment in the gatekeeper module. Do not re-enable without legal sign-off. Full experiment writeup, dashboards, and decision log are here.

dashboard of kafop-yagep = https://jira.zemvarsys.internal/pages/pages/pages/display/cc87

# Closure: Penwick Office (Managers Only)

The Penwick satellite office closes at quarter-end. Lease terminates under the early-exit clause; penalty already accrued. Staff: four relocate to Dunmore, two accept severance. Finance actions: final payroll run, asset write-down on fixtures, and reallocation of the facilities budget to Dunmore.

Closure costs land in this quarter; savings begin next quarter.

The confidential note on follow-on plans is recorded below.

internal memo for kawip-hadug: Headcount on the Wenwyn team goes from 7 to 140 by the end of January. Gross margin on Wenwyn came in at 20 percent against a plan of 15 percent.